About the role
ADP is hiring a Payroll Business Partner I servicing ADP's Professional Employer Organization (PEO) solution, where clients outsource their Human Resources functions. You will utilize your knowledge and resources to provide clients with specialized support and guidance to achieve their goals. You carry the weight of ADP's service reputation and client satisfaction in your hands. Every day, you'll be the primary client liaison for all employer-level concerns and will provide first-level support predominately over the phone for several complex functional areas. It's critically important that our PEO clients remain compliant with all Federal, State, and Local employment and tax laws. As a result, Payroll Business Partners must closely monitor, evaluate and, at times, prevent or redirect client actions. The level of complexity, attention to detail, and knowledge required far exceed that of non-PEO environments. Our top-ranked training will help to set you up for success!
This role is responsible for acting as a trusted payroll advisor and client service professional by providing timely and accurate advice around payroll compliance and delivering payroll solutions that positively impact the client's business and create client retention and growth. This role troubleshoots client and product challenges, educates clients, develops partnerships with stakeholders and creates the environment to demonstrate the depth, breadth and level of care that creates value in the ADP client relationship.
